About this role
The Field Service Report Reviewer at EOLA Power is responsible for reviewing and validating Field Service Reports completed by Field Service Engineers. This role focuses on ensuring the accuracy, completeness, and professionalism of reports before they are shared with clients and internal teams, while also providing support in generating quotes based on service findings. The position requires a detail-oriented approach to maintain quality standards and protect revenue.

What you need
-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
- Proficiency in Excel and digital documentation systems
- Strong written communication skills
- Ability to learn technical material through training and repetition
Nice to have
- Experience in critical power, UPS systems, batteries, or technical service environments
